Key responsibilities will include:

The Department of Aviation seeks a highly skilled Safety and Industrial Hygiene Administrator (Certified Industrial Hygienist) to join the Airport Safety Team to support the departmental divisions, business units and many partner organizations. The Safety and Industrial Hygiene Administrator (Certified Industrial Hygienist) will contribute to the safety and well-being of our employees and visitors. As a prominent organization committed to excellence, we are looking for an experienced professional to uphold the highest industrial hygiene standards

  • Conduct comprehensive industrial hygiene assessments to identify and evaluate workplace hazards.

  • Develop and implement effective control measures to mitigate exposure to occupational health risks.

  • Perform air quality monitoring, noise assessments, and ergonomic evaluations.

  • Collaborate with various departments to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and industry best practices.

  • Provide expertise and guidance on the selection and use of personal protective equipment (PPE).

  • Analyze and interpret data to prepare detailed reports on industrial hygiene findings and recommendations.

  • Conduct training sessions to educate employees on industrial hygiene principles and practices.

  • Conducting safety audits/risk assessments

  • Providing on-demand regulatory guidance to airlines and departments

  • Identifying controls to mitigate risk identified in risk assessments

  • Assisting with Incident Analysis

  • Hazard investigation and follow-up

  • Supporting the development and implementation of Safety Management System (SMS)

  • Performing other duties as required or requested
